[Bug 238629] Re: [i965] Java plugin causes massive Xorg CPU usage, fixed with XAA (UXA/EXA)

2017-09-06 Thread os2
I don't believe this has been properly resolved.
As of this date I am still experiencing this issue with updated Intel hardware 
as well as current Kernel/modesetting driver and current Xorg.

The default Xorg Intel driver mode is SNA. I have tried also tried UXA
and XAA. The issue persists. I also removed the Xorg Intel driver
completely to run in native modesetting. Xorg CPU usage still remains >
75-90% in all cases.

This could well have to do with java settings and/or badly implemented
java apps. Not sure.

[Bug 238629] Re: [i965] Java plugin causes massive Xorg CPU usage, fixed with XAA (UXA/EXA)

2014-02-20 Thread David Matějček
It seems that this bug is also cause of the Eclipse 4.x crashes (and high CPU 
load and hanging)
https://bugs.eclipse.org/bugs/show_bug.cgi?id=397291

I have maybe 10 dumps beginning with the following:
#  SIGSEGV (0xb) at pc=0x7fe9bb3dd92a, pid=7396, tid=140643637405440
#
# JRE version: OpenJDK Runtime Environment (7.0_51) (build 1.7.0_51-b00)
# Java VM: OpenJDK 64-Bit Server VM (24.45-b08 mixed mode linux-amd64 
compressed oops)
# Problematic frame:
# C  [libgtk-x11-2.0.so.0+0x24492a]  gtk_widget_queue_draw+0x1a
#

The XAA Option evidently helped.
Firefox did not crash before this change and does not crash even after that.
Eclipse did not crash after this change and is much faster (does not slow down 
after hours of work on the big workspace).

Kubuntu 13.10 64bit, Dell Latitude E6520 with i5 CPU.
